Also available is the 'flags' property. Drawcalls have different flags and properties
and these can be queried with a filter such as $draw(flags & Clear|ClearDepthStencil)
<p>
Also available is the <code>flags</code> property. Drawcalls have different flags and properties
and these can be queried with a filter such as <code>$draw(flags & Clear|ClearDepthStencil)</code>
</p>
<p>The flags available are:</p>
<table>
<tr><td>Clear:</td> <td>This is a clear call, clearing all or a subset of a resource.</td></tr>
<tr><td>Drawcall:</td> <td>This is a graphics pipeline drawcall, rasterizing polygons.</td></tr>
<tr><td>Dispatch:</td> <td>This is a compute dispatch.</td></tr>
<tr><td>CmdList:</td> <td>This is part of the book-keeping for a command list, secondary command buffer or bundle.</td></tr>
<tr><td>SetMarker:</td> <td>This is an individual string debug marker, with no children.</td></tr>
<tr><td>PushMarker:</td> <td>This is a push of a debug marker region, with some child drawcalls</td></tr>
<tr><td>PopMarker:</td> <td>This is the pop of a debug marker region.</td></tr>
<tr><td>Present:</td> <td>This is a graphics present to a window.</td></tr>
<tr><td>MultiDraw:</td> <td>This is part of a multi-draw drawcall.</td></tr>
<tr><td>Copy:</td> <td>This is a copy call, copying between one resource and another.</td></tr>
<tr><td>Resolve:</td> <td>This is a resolve or non-identical blit, as opposed to a copy.</td></tr>
<tr><td>GenMips:</td> <td>This call is generating mip-maps for a texture</td></tr>
<tr><td>PassBoundary:</td> <td>This is the boundary of a 'pass' explicitly denoted by the API.</td></tr>
<tr><td>Indexed:</td> <td>For graphics pipeline drawcalls, the call uses an index buffer.</td></tr>
<tr><td>Instanced:</td> <td>For graphics pipeline drawcalls, the call uses instancing.</td></tr>
<tr><td>Auto:</td> <td>For graphics pipeline drawcalls, it's automatic based on stream-out.</td></tr>
<tr><td>Indirect:</td> <td>This is an indirect call, sourcing parameters from the GPU.</td></tr>
<tr><td>ClearColor:</td> <td>For clear calls, color values are cleared.</td></tr>
<tr><td>ClearDepthStencil:</td> <td>For clear calls, depth/stencil values are cleared.</td></tr>
<tr><td>BeginPass:</td> <td>For pass boundaries, this begins a pass. A boundary could begin and end.</td></tr>
<tr><td>EndPass:</td> <td>For pass boundaries, this ends a pass. A boundary could begin and end.</td></tr>
<tr><td>CommandBufferBoundary:</td> <td>This denotes the boundary of an entire command buffer.</td></tr>
</table>

Filters loosely follow a general search-term syntax, by default matching an event
if any of the terms matches. E.g. a filter such as:
<p>
Draw Clear Copy
<pre> Draw Clear Copy</pre>
<p>
would match each string against event names, and include any event that matches
"Draw" OR "Clear" OR "Copy".
<code>Draw</code> OR <code>Clear</code> OR <code>Copy</code>.
</p>
<p>
You can also exclude matches with - such as:
</p>
Draw Clear Copy -Depth
<pre> Draw Clear Copy -Depth</pre>
<p>
which will match as in the first example, except exclude any events that match
'Depth'.
<code>Depth<code>.
</p>
<p>
You can also require matches, which overrides any optional matches:
</p>
+Draw +Indexed -Instanced
<pre> +Draw +Indexed -Instanced</pre>
which will match only events which match "Draw" and match "Indexed" but don't match
"Instanced". In this case adding a term with no + or - prefix will be ignored,
<p>
which will match only events which match <code>Draw<code> and match <code>Indexed<code> but don't match
<code>Instanced<code>. In this case adding a term with no + or - prefix will be ignored,
since an event will be excluded if it doesn't match all the +required terms
anyway.
</p>
<p>
More complex expressions can be built with nesting:
</p>
+Draw +(Indexed Instanced) -Indirect
<pre> +Draw +(Indexed Instanced) -Indirect</pre>
Would match only events matching "Draw" which also match at least one of "Indexed"
or "Instanced" but not "Indirect".
<p>
Would match only events matching <code>Draw<code> which also match at least one of <code>Indexed<code>
or <code>Instanced<code> but not <code>Indirect<code>.
</p>
<p>
Finally you can use filter functions for more advanced matching than just
strings. These are documented on the left here, but for example
</p>
$draw(numIndices > 1000) Indexed
<pre> $draw(numIndices > 1000) Indexed</pre>
<p>
will include any drawcall that matches "Indexed" as a plain string match, OR
renders more than 1000 indices.
</p>
